Iran strikes US base in Saudi | Trump says ‘Cuba is next’ | Tiger Woods charged after car crash

The Red Crescent says civilian areas in Iran are being increasingly hit in US-Israeli strikes. Iran-backed Houthi rebels have launched a missile at Israel, which the IDF says was intercepted. And Iran has struck a key US military base in Saudi Arabia, injuring at least 12 service personnel and damaging refuelling aircraft.
